NK0429 : Pottie Murlan

taken 23 years ago, near to Collieston, Aberdeenshire, Scotland

Pottie Murlan
Pottie Murlan
This is a splendid example of a tight recumbent fold, showing the forces which deformed these Dalradian rocks during the Caledonian mountain building 400 million years ago.
